Just curious I noticed my test kits have expired. What are the main things i should test for in my tank.

15859322003464324555866395439617.jpg
I would say the things that you must test are Alk, Ca, Mag, Phosphate, and Nitrate. There are others that you can test for, but if you keep these 5 in check and do regular water changes (~20% every 2-3 weeks). you will keep the tank in good shape.

What is the best type of water tester. I understand the one with the drops is junk and there are better ways to do it.

No one size fits all that I have found. I use Salifert kits for Alk, Mg and Calcium. I have tried a few fancy Redsea pro kits in the past and use an Apex probe for PH and a Refractometer for Salinity. Dont really test for anything else these days.

The little Hanna Eggs are good for PO4 (low range). I could never get consistent results from their Calcium egg, may have been user error.

Water change day!!! Do you all think changing out two pails of water out of a 75 gallon tank once a week is two much???

If you are talking 5 gallon buckets, then you would be doing about 15% weekly. This is a pretty good water change. I try to do about 20 gallons every other week, which equates to about the same as you are doing.

Then I would just do one per week. You are wasting a lot of RODI and salt doing nearly a 50% weekly water change. Most reefers will change ~10% weekly up to maybe 50% monthly.
